Giga-MiniMc, SFP, TX-SX, TX-LX ABOUT THE GIG A-MINIMC The Giga-MiniMc is a 10/100/1000 auto-negotiating, switching miniature media converter. The fiber port available in one pair of SC fiber connectors and/or an SFP port which can support any fiber type; dual strand available in LC connectors, and single strand fiber SFPs available in SC connectors.

Giga-MiniMc, SFP, TX-SX, TX-LX FIBER OPTIC CLEANING GUIDELINES Fiber Optic transmitters and receivers are extremely susceptible to contamination by particles of dirt or dust that can obstruct the optic path and cause performance degradation. Good system performance requires clean optics and connector ferrules. Use fiber patch cords (or connectors if you terminate your own fiber) only from a reputable supplier;...
